4. How to Find the LCM of 340 and 341?

Answer:

Least Common Multiple of 340 and 341 = 115940

Step 1: Find the prime factorization of 340

340 = 2 x 2 x 5 x 17

Step 2: Find the prime factorization of 341

341 = 11 x 31

Step 3: Multiply each factor the greater number of times it occurs in steps i) or ii) above to find the lcm:

LCM = 115940 = 2 x 2 x 5 x 11 x 17 x 31

Step 4: Therefore, the least common multiple of 340 and 341 is 115940.
